Frameless Shower Door Glass Thickness: What You Need

Quick Answer: Most frameless shower doors use 3/8-inch tempered glass, the standard for rigidity and everyday spans. Half-inch glass is the heaviest option for a solid feel and larger panels, while 5/16-inch suits smaller, lighter panels and shorter runs. All shower glass should be tempered safety glass.

A frameless shower door has no metal channel wrapped around its edges to keep it stiff and square. The glass itself does the whole job of staying flat, holding its shape, and carrying the weight of the door swing. That single fact drives every thickness decision that follows, so it helps to understand the "why" before the numbers.

Why Frameless Glass Has To Be Thicker

A framed shower door is a thinner sheet of glass held inside an aluminum surround on all four sides. The metal frame is the structure. It braces the panel, keeps it rigid, and hides the raw edges, so the glass inside can be relatively thin (often around 3/16 inch or 1/4 inch) and still feel stable because the frame is doing the stiffening work.

Pull the frame away, and the glass loses its brace. Now the panel has to resist flexing, twisting, and sagging entirely on its own. A thin sheet with no frame would bow when you push the door and wobble when it swings. The fix is mass: thicker glass is stiffer, holds a flat plane, and stays square across a tall span. That is the core trade of going frameless. You gain a clean, open, hardware-light look, and you pay for it with heavier, thicker glass and sturdier mounting.

Thickness in shower glass is usually given in inches, and the jump from one size to the next is not just a bigger number. Each step up adds noticeable weight and stiffness, which changes the hinges, the hardware, and how the wall behind the tile has to be prepared.

The Standard Frameless Options

Three thicknesses cover nearly all frameless work. They are not interchangeable, and the right one depends on panel size, door span, and how solid you want the door to feel in the hand.

3/8 Inch: The Common Choice: Three-eighths-inch glass is the workhorse of frameless showers and the option most homeowners end up with. It is thick enough to stand rigid without a frame, handles a normal-size door and return panel comfortably, and swings with a reassuring stiffness. It also tends to be the most versatile of the true frameless thicknesses, easy to hang on standard hinges and hardware, which is part of why it is so common. For a typical single door with a fixed panel, 3/8 inch is usually the default recommendation.

1/2 Inch: The Premium Feel: Half-inch glass is the heaviest and most substantial of the usual options. It has the most solid, vault-like feel when you open and close it, and it holds a flat plane across wider and taller panels where thinner glass might start to flex. That heft comes with requirements. Half-inch panels are heavy, so they need stronger hinges and heavier-duty hardware rated for the load, and the wall behind the mounting points has to be properly backed to carry the weight. It is the premium pick for large enclosures, oversized doors, and anyone who wants the glass to feel as heavy and expensive as it looks.

5/16 Inch: The Lighter Middle: Five-sixteenths-inch glass sits between framed thinness and full frameless heft. It is lighter and easier to handle than 3/8 inch and works well for smaller panels, short fixed screens, and lighter door configurations where the full weight of 3/8 or 1/2 inch is not needed. It is less common than 3/8 inch and is best matched to modest spans rather than tall, wide statement enclosures. Think of it as the efficient option for a compact layout rather than a downgrade.

Every Option Must Be Tempered

Whatever thickness you pick, the glass must be tempered. Tempered glass is heat-treated safety glass, and it behaves very differently from ordinary annealed glass if it ever fails. Instead of breaking into long, knife-like shards, it fractures into a mass of small, blunt, pebble-like pieces that are far less likely to cause a serious cut. In a wet room where people are barefoot and moving around, that behavior is the whole point.

You can usually confirm a panel is tempered by finding the small etched or sandblasted stamp in one corner, often called the bug or mark, which names the maker and the safety standard. If you cannot find that stamp, treat the glass as unverified and have it checked before it goes in.

Tempered glass is very strong across its face but sensitive at its edges. A chip or a nick in the edge can, in rare cases, lead to a spontaneous break days or even weeks later as internal stress finds the flaw. These panels should be handled and set by people who do it for a living, not muscled into place on a whim.

How Thickness Changes The Hardware And The Wall

Thickness is not only about the glass. It sets the spec for everything the glass touches.

Hinges and clamps are cut and rated for a specific glass thickness, so 3/8-inch hardware and 1/2-inch hardware are not the same parts. Heavier glass needs hinges engineered to carry more weight and hold alignment over years of daily swinging, and the door has to be balanced so it neither drifts open nor slams shut.

The wall matters just as much. A loaded frameless panel puts real prying force on its mounting points, and those anchors cannot rely on tile and drywall alone. Tile is a finish, not structure, and a screw set only into drywall will eventually work loose under a heavy swinging door. The mount needs to reach solid wood: the studs behind the wall, or blocking added between the studs during the build specifically to catch the hardware. Under-anchoring a heavy panel is a genuine safety hazard, because a door that pulls free can fall and shatter. This is one of the strongest reasons professional measuring and installation matter, since the installer has to locate or add that backing before the glass ever hangs.

Weight also shapes the door swing and the daily experience. Heavier glass swings with more authority and settles more firmly, but it demands that everything upstream, from hinge to anchor to backing, is sized to match. Get the chain right, and the door feels effortless. Get one link wrong, and a beautiful panel becomes a nagging problem.

Panel Size And Span Point You To A Thickness

The single biggest driver of thickness is how large a piece of glass you are asking to stand on its own. A small return panel and a modest door can live happily on thinner glass. A tall, wide fixed panel or an oversized single door has more unsupported area, more prying force, and more tendency to flex, so it wants more thickness to stay flat and stable.

Height plays into this too. A taller panel has a longer lever arm, which magnifies any flex, so tall enclosures lean toward 3/8 or 1/2 inch. Where a design carries a lot of glass across a long opening, a header or brace across the top can add support and let a given thickness span farther, which is one way large layouts stay rigid. The reach of a swinging door also feeds the decision, since a wide door hangs more weight off its hinges the farther it opens.

The practical read is simple. Small and light points toward 5/16 inch, standard points toward 3/8 inch, and large, tall, or heavy-duty points toward 1/2 inch. A good installer matches the thickness to the actual dimensions of your opening rather than defaulting to one size for everything.

Coatings, Etching, And What Thickness Will Not Fix

A common misunderstanding is that thicker glass resists water spots and cloudiness better. It does not. Hard-water etching is a surface chemistry problem, not a thickness problem. Mineral-laden water dries on the glass, leaves deposits, and over time can etch faint cloudy marks into the surface. A half-inch panel etches just as readily as a thinner one, because the etching happens on the face, not through the body.

The real defense against hard-water etching is a protective coating. Many frameless panels can be treated with a clear hydrophobic sealant that makes the surface slicker, so water beads and sheets off instead of clinging and drying in place. It does not make the glass maintenance-free, but it makes routine squeegeeing far more effective and slows the buildup that leads to etching. Choose thickness for structure and feel; choose a coating for keeping the glass clear.

Matching Thickness To The Space

Once the safety and structural basics are covered, the choice comes down to the look and feel you want and the size of the opening, kept in that order. Weight climbs with thickness, and heavier glass needs sturdier hinges and firmer wall anchoring, so 1/2 inch sits at the top for heft and span, 3/8 inch in the middle for everyday openings, and 5/16 inch at the light end for compact panels. None of the three is a lesser panel; they are all real frameless glass, just sized to different jobs.

For most homeowners, 3/8 inch is the balanced answer: rigid, handsome, and sensible. Step up to 1/2 inch when the enclosure is large, or you specifically want that heavy, high-end feel and are ready for the hardware and wall backing it requires. Drop to 5/16 inch when the panels are small, and you want to trim weight and hardware load without going framed. The best decision comes from measuring the actual opening, confirming the wall can be anchored properly, and matching all of it to how you want the finished shower to look and feel.

Frequently Asked Questions

Can I switch from a framed door to frameless without changing my walls?

Not always. Framed doors often anchor into the frame's own channel, which spreads load and forgives a weaker wall. Going frameless usually means new anchor points that must hit studs or added blocking, and if your existing wall lacks backing where the new hardware lands, the installer may need to open the wall or relocate mounts. It is worth confirming before you commit to the switch.

Does thicker glass make a shower door quieter or is it just heavier?

Both, to a degree. Beyond the added weight, thicker glass has more mass to dampen vibration, so it tends to swing with less rattle and closes with a lower, more muffled sound rather than a thin sharp click. Soft-close or hydraulic hinges do more for quietness than thickness alone, but the heavier panel does contribute a steadier, more solid acoustic.

How much does 1/2-inch shower glass actually weigh?

Half-inch tempered glass runs roughly 6.5 pounds per square foot, so a single door panel can weigh well over a hundred pounds. Three-eighths-inch glass is closer to 5 pounds per square foot. That difference is exactly why 1/2 inch demands beefier hinges and confirmed wall blocking rather than the same hardware you would use on a lighter panel.

Is low-iron glass worth it, and does it change the thickness I need?

Low-iron glass removes the faint green tint that standard glass shows on its edges, giving a clearer, more true-to-color look, which is popular on thicker panels where the edge is more visible. It is a purity choice, not a strength choice, so it does not change the thickness your span requires. You pick the thickness for structure and separately decide whether you want low-iron for clarity.

What edge finish should frameless glass have and why does it matter?

Frameless edges are exposed, so they are typically given a polished or flat-polished finish rather than a raw or seamed edge. Beyond looks, a smooth polished edge removes the tiny nicks that can seed a spontaneous break in tempered glass. A clean, well-finished edge is both a safety feature and a sign the fabricator handled the panel carefully.

Can I drill or modify tempered glass after it is installed?

No. Tempered glass cannot be cut, drilled, or notched after tempering; any attempt will shatter the entire panel because the surface tension releases at once. Every hole, cutout, and hinge notch is made in the annealed sheet before it goes through the tempering oven. If a panel needs a new opening later, it has to be remade from scratch, which is why accurate measuring up front is so important.
